Перевод текста "Let's get started!

" Spillane shouted to make himself heard above the roar of the wind.

Jerry slowly and carefully let the car go, and the drum began to go round and round.

Jerry carefully watched the cable passing round the drum.

"Three hundred feet" he was saying to himself, "three hundred and fifty, four hundred –" The cable stopped.

Something had gone wrong.

The boy examined the drum closely and found nothing the matter with it.

Probably it was the drum on the other side that had been damaged .

He was afraid at the thought of the man and woman hanging out there over the river in the driving rain.

Nothing remained but to cross over to the other side by the Yellow Dragon cable some distance up the river.

He was already wet to the skin as he ran along the path to the Yellow Dragon.

Safely across, he found his way up the other bank to the Yellow Dream cable.

To his surprise, he found the drum in perfect working order.

From this side the car with the Spillanes was only two hundred and fifty feet away.

So he shouted to the man to examine the trolley of his car.

The answering cry came in a few moments.

"She's all right, kid!

" Nothing remained but the other car which hung somewhere beyond Spillane's car.

The boy's mind had been made up.

In the toolbox by the drum he found an old monkey - wrench, a short iron bar and a few feet of rope.

With the rope he made a large loop round the cable on which the empty car was hanging.

Then he swung out over the river, sitting in the rope loop and began pulling himself along the cable by his hands.

And in the midst of the storm which half blinded him he arrived at the empty car in his swinging loop.

A single glance was enough to show him what was wrong.

The front trolley wheel had jumped off the cable, and the cable had been jammed between the wheel and the fork.

It was clear that the wheel must be removed from the fork.

He began hammering on the key that held the wheel on its axle.

He hammered at it with one hand and tried to hold himself steady with the other.

The wind kept on swinging his body and often made his blows miss.

At the end of half an hour the key had been hammered clear but still he could not draw it out.

A dozen times it seemed to him that he must give up in despair.

Then an idea came to him – he searched his pockets and found a nail.

Putting the nail through the looped head of the key he easily pulled it out.

With the help of the iron bar Jerry got the wheel free, replaced the wheel, and by means of the rope pulled up the car till the trolley once more rested properly on the cable.

He dropped out of his loop and down into the car which began moving at once.

Soon he saw the bank rising before him and the old familiar drum going round and round.

Jerry climbed out and made the car fast.

Then he sank down by the drum and burst out crying.

He cried because he was tired out, because his hands were all cut and cold and because he was so excited.

But above all that was the feeling that he had done well, that the man and woman had been saved.

Yes, Jerry was proud of himself and at the same time sorry that his father had not been there to see!

(разных типов) Once upon a time, on an uninhabited island on the shores of the Red Sea, there lived a Parsee from whose hat the rays of the sun were reflected in more - than - oriental splendour.

And the Parsee lived by the Red Sea with nothing but his hat and his knife and a cooking - stove of the kind that you must particularly never touch.

And one day he took flour and water and currants and plums and sugar and things, and made himself one cake which was two feet across and three feet thick.

It was indeed a Superior Comestible (that's magic), and he put it on stove because he was allowed to cook on the stove, and he baked it and he baked it till it was all done brown and smelt most sentimental.

But just as he was going to eat it there came down to the beach from the Altogether Uninhabited Interior one Rhinoceros with a horn on his nose, two piggy eyes, and few manners.

In those days the Rhinoceros's skin fitted him quite tight.

There were no wrinkles in it anywhere.

He looked exactly like a Noah's Ark Rhinoceros, but of course much bigger.

All the same, he had no manners then, and he has no manners now, and he never will have any manners.

He said, 'How!

' And the Parsee left that cake and climbed to the top of a palm tree with nothing on but his hat, from which the rays of the sun were always reflected in more - than - oriental splendour.

And the Rhinoceros upset the oil - stove with his nose, and the cake rolled on the sand, and he spiked that cake on the horn of his nose, and he ate it, and he went away, waving his tail, to the desolate and Exclusively Uninhabited Interior which abuts on the islands of Mazanderan, Socotra, and Promontories of the Larger Equinox.

Then the Parsee came down from his palm - tree and put the stove on its legs and recited the following Sloka, which, as you have not heard, I will now proceed to relate : Them that takes cakes Which the Parsee - man bakes Makes dreadful mistakes.

And there was a great deal more in that than you would think.

Because, five weeks later, there was a heat wave in the Red Sea, and everybody took off all the clothes they had.

The Parsee took off his hat ; but the Rhinoceros took off his skin and carried it over his shoulder as he came down to the beach to bathe.

In those days it buttoned underneath with three buttons and looked like a waterproof.

He said nothing whatever about the Parsee's cake, because he had eaten it all ; and he never had any manners, then, since, or henceforward.

He waddled straight into the water and blew bubbles through his nose, leaving his skin on the beach.

Presently the Parsee came by and found the skin, and he smiled one smile that ran all round his face two times.

Then he danced three times round the skin and rubbed his hands.

Then he went to his camp and filled his hat with cake - crumbs, for the Parsee never ate anything but cake, and never swept out his camp.

He took that skin, and he shook that skin, and he scrubbed that skin, and he rubbed that skin just as full of old, dry, stale, tickly cake - crumbs and some burned currants as ever it could possibly hold.

Then he climbed to the top of his palm - tree and waited for the Rhinoceros to come out of the water and put it on.

And the Rhinoceros did.

He buttoned it up with the three buttons, and it tickled like cake crumbs in bed.

Then he wanted to scratch, but that made it worse ; and then he lay down on the sands and rolled and rolled and rolled, and every time he rolled the cake crumbs tickled him worse and worse and worse.

Then he ran to the palm - tree and rubbed and rubbed and rubbed himself against it.

He rubbed so much and so hard that he rubbed his skin into a great fold over his shoulders, and another fold underneath, where the buttons used to be (but he rubbed the buttons off), and he rubbed some more folds over his legs.

And it spoiled his temper, but it didn't make the least difference to the cake - crumbs.

They were inside his skin and they tickled.

So he went home, very angry indeed and horribly scratchy ; and from that day to this every rhinoceros has great folds in his skin and a very bad temper, all on account of the cake - crumbs inside.

But the Parsee came down from his palm - tree, wearing his hat, from which the rays of the sun were reflected in more - than - oriental splendour, packed up his cooking - stove, and went away in the direction of Orotavo, Amygdala, the Upland Meadows of Anantarivo, and the Marshes of Sonaput.
